检测input、textarea输入改变事件有以下几种: 1、 onkeyup/onkeydown 捕获用户键盘输入事件。 缺陷:复制粘贴时无法检测 2、 onchenge 缺陷:要满足触发条件:当前对象的属性改变(由键盘或鼠标 ...
实时检测 input textarea输入改变事件,支持低版本IE,支持复制粘贴 检测input textarea输入改变事件有以下几种: onkeyup onkeydown捕获用户键盘输入事件。 缺陷:复制粘贴时无法检测 onchenge 缺陷:要满足触发条件:当前对象的属性改变 由键盘或鼠标触发 且对象失去焦点 onpropertychange当前对象属性改变就会触发 缺陷:只支持低版本IE ...
2017-05-15 15:29 0 1498 推荐指数:
检测input、textarea输入改变事件有以下几种: 1、 onkeyup/onkeydown 捕获用户键盘输入事件。 缺陷:复制粘贴时无法检测 2、 onchenge 缺陷:要满足触发条件:当前对象的属性改变(由键盘或鼠标 ...
1.背景 在IE低版本中(IE11以下),input输入框类型为number时,可以输入除了数字之外的其他字符,因此需要做改进。 我在网上找了相关的资料,借鉴了一位博主的文章,该博主的文章地址:https://blog.csdn.net/fxss5201/article/details ...
通知:博客已搬家到CSDN地址为:https://blog.csdn.net/hdp134793 有关inputs输入内容的事件监听,一般我们会想到下面几个关键词:oninput,onpropertychange,onchange oninput与onchange的一个区分 oninput ...
项目中要用到监听input框的输入值,差实时更新数据,开始用input的onchange 方法,但onchange方法必必须要在失去焦点的情况下才能触发,很明显无法满足我们的需求。 图1: 图2 如图2所示,输入关键字,立即将结果显示在下方方框中,以实现实时查看 ...
前端页面开发的很多情况下都需要实时监听文本框输入,比如腾讯微博编写140字的微博时输入框hu9i动态显示还可以输入的字数。过去一般都使用onchange/onkeyup/onkeypress/onkeydown实现,但是这存在着一些不好的用户体验。比如onchange事件只在键盘或者鼠标操作改变 ...
一、相应的事件 copy: 在发生复制操作时触发。 beforecut: 在发生剪切操作 前 触发。 cut: 在 发生 剪切 操作 时 触发。 beforepaste: 在 发生 粘贴 操作 前 触发。 paste: 在 发生 粘贴 操作 时 触发。 相应的事件中,以before开头 ...
html5提供的一些新标签(article,aside,dialog,footer,header,section,footer,nav,figure,menu)使用起来非常的方便,但是低版本的IE浏览器(IE6/IE7/IE8)对的这些新标签“视而不见”,根本识别不了,不免让前端工作者们望而却步 ...
oninput事件: 在用户进行输入,元素值发生改变时立即触发;(元素值改变立即触发) 缺陷: 从脚本中修改值不会触发事件。从浏览器下拉提示框里选取值时不会触发。IE9 以下不支持,所以IE9以下可用onpropertychange 事件代替 onchange事件 ...